Tree House – Sunshower Cold Brew Coffee

 

Smells of roasted coffee, toffee, and caramel. The taste is lightly tart with a touch of sweetness and flavors of raspberry, cherry, green apple, salted caramel, and honey on a smooth medium body. The finish is long and moderately low in acidity and virtually no bitterness, featuring notes of grape leaves, lemon juice, dark chocolate, and a touch of smoke. Overall, it’s the most interesting one yet, I really like the variety of flavors layered throughout, but I’m still not a fan of the acidity. Adding cream thankfully hides some of it.
